Noah Cyrus released her first single, “Make Me (Cry)” this Tuesday.

With family influences of sister, Miley Cyrus, and father, Billy Ray Cyrus, it is no wonder that Noah has also decided to dip her toe into the music industry.

Upon first listening to the song, I could definitely sense some influence from Miley.

Though they have similarities, Noah’s voice has a unique tone that is all her own and different than that of her older sister.

Touching lyrics of heartbreak combined with a powerful bassline creates a track that pulls you in instantly.

The track also features Labrinth, a British singer and songwriter who has previously worked with The Weeknd.

“Gave you up ‘bout 21 times. Felt those lips tell me 21 lies” they duet in the first verse.

I was definitely intrigued with Noah’s first single and can’t wait to see where her music goes from here.
